Output 31d794407b38c43c7afb0187b784a2b01c2f95e706b581cd577bf1df725e69f6:1

value
41531275
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57337886f97f9194ee33ca9deb31a43fffc94951 OP_EQUALVERIFY OP_CHECKSIG
address
18x5SwjujvW9ST8aG7x1NLdGHGnAX7pkiG
transaction
31d794407b38c43c7afb0187b784a2b01c2f95e706b581cd577bf1df725e69f6
spent
true